Epistemological status: existential AI safety suggestions as a set of bullet pointsTL;DR We need to be clear about what behavior we’re trying to train when we align AIs — aligned behavior is not the default for an LLM whose behavior is distilled from ours, nor for an RL-trained maximizer.
